Over time the sound of the engines fades to background noise; by now the thrum of the ship's systems under his feet is as ubiquitous and no more worthy of notice than his own heartbeat. The low hum of the engines is a comfort, only truly audible when the sound of it is wrong. At the moment the particular pitch and volume of the vibration indicates that the FTL engines are operating at somewhat reduced capacity. Their energy reserves are depleted. They'll have to refuel before too much longer.

A hint of a smile curls around the corner of his mouth as she mentions the code. "You have an extremely suspicious mind," he comments, and though the phrasing could easily be an insult, the tone makes it unmistakably a compliment. A prudent and reasonable level of paranoia is certainly something he can respect.

"I'll need to memorise it one way or the other," he replies with a slight shrug. The transfer the stones allow is a purely mental one, and any notes he might make will be left behind when they make the switch. "Go ahead."
